With the 20th anniversary, \u201cRise of the Tomb Raider: 20 Year Celebration\u201d was released on Oct.11. The new edition includes many new features, such as virtual reality and multiplayer.<\/p>\n<p>The game also has a new downloadable expansion called \u201cBlood Ties\u201d. This addition to the story explains Lara Croft\u2019s family bonds and doesn\u2019t add many new details to the story, but rather, enforces some content that was lightly mentioned throughout the plot of the game. The playthrough of this is more story-based so there isn\u2019t much action, but there is a lot of time to connect the dots. This is also playable for anyone with a virtual reality device through free hand control or a move-click system as a form of movement. However, it looks smooth enough without the system and can cause motion sickness.<\/p>\n<p>Another feature of the game which is unlockable after completing the Blood Ties story is a similar playthrough except with the addition of zombies and a more eerie environment to play in. When playing, it\u2019s difficult to really know the direction from where a zombie might appear. The dark environment is no help to this, as it has a small field of view with mixed audio signals in a cramped space with multiple pathways for zombies to approach.<\/p>\n<p>I like the new multiplayer mode, although it\u2019s not competitive. It has a survival component with another player and both players need to rely on each other for food and supplies as well as exploring booby trapped maps that are randomly generated each playthrough.<\/p>\n<p>I would recommend this game to anyone that has played the previous \u201cRise of the Tomb Raider\u201d and who wants to experience something new with an additional challenge and highly recommend it for people that have not. This is a game that has lasted 20 years in an ever-changing gaming community.
